Franklin didn't participate in the divorce lawsuit. Emily and her mother came out, and the driver waited at the door in his car.

First, she and her mother thanked Mr. Smith, then her old classmate, and then she helped her mother into the car.

She didn't expect that Franklin, who didn't come, would be in the car. Emily was shocked, and Abigail was even more shocked.

"Why are you here? Didn't you say you were busy today?" Emily asked.

Franklin said indifferently, "After everything was settled, I decided to take a look. How's it going? Are you satisfied with the result?"

Emily nodded, her eyes shining, and she said happily, "Yes, of course, I'm very satisfied. I really didn't expect Mr. Smith to be so good. It's really unexpected. You didn't even see how bad that scum Hunter looked when he came out. It was so gratifying."

Franklin looked at her happy face and couldn't help but smile.

Abigail sat awkwardly by the side. It didn't matter if Franklin was still her son-in-law. But the thing was that they were divorced, and Franklin had a fiancee. It made her feel very uncomfortable that they were like this.

But it was hard for her to point it out in front of Franklin. Emily was just grateful to Mr. Smith and didn't think about that.

But she knew that it would not have gone so smoothly without Franklin. Even if they had the ability to hire Mr. Smith, they still had to rely on Franklin for the evidence and other matters.

So she just sat there without saying a word and watched her daughter being silly.

Emily asked the driver to send them to the hotel first, and her mother was still staying at the hotel for the time being.

Although the house was taken back, Abigail did not intend to go back to live in it. It was a sad place, and it would only add to her sadness if she returned.

"Why don't you sell that house? Then you can get a down payment and buy one somewhere else." Emily suggested.

Abigail nodded and said, "Well, that's a good idea. I have thought about that."

"I do have a house available. If auntie doesn't mind, you can stay there for a while. You can always move out there if you find a better choice in the future. It takes time to buy a house." Franklin said.

Abigail said awkwardly, "Mr. Brent, you're so thoughtful. Thank you for your kindness. But... I'll have to discuss this with Emily. You're a busy man, and I don't dare to delay you for too long. Don't mind me if you have something to attend to!"

Franklin chuckled, for it was obvious that she was driving him away!

Emily also noticed it and looked at Franklin uneasily, afraid that he would lose his temper.

She wouldn't worry about it in the past. But ever since he came back, Franklin's temper had changed. If he lost his temper and said something bad to his mother, what would she do then?

Fortunately, Franklin only nodded after chuckling and then really left.

Emily secretly heaved a sigh of relief. Fortunately, he did not lose his temper.

Abigail looked at her with mixed feelings and said quietly, "Emily, what's going on between you and him?"

Emily pursed her lips and gritted her teeth, "Mom, I didn't want to tell you about this. But now that you mentioned it, I'll explain. I'm only by his side for the time being. But he won't let me go, I have no choice. I was worried about what you would do if I left. After all, you still have Hunter. If Hunter doesn't leave, you definitely can't leave. If Franklin can't find me, he will definitely come after you. Now that you divorce Hunter, I'm relieved. Take this opportunity. Sell that house and live somewhere else! Find out where do you want to go. Take a look first and then settle down, far from Lancaster."

"Do you mean I should leave Lancaster and hide somewhere else?" Abigail said in surprise.
